The Utility Maintenance Technician I works under the direct supervision of the Utility Superintendent. This entry level skilled position will be assigned various basic duties and tasks necessary for the operation of public water and wastewater utilities and associated utility facilities for the City of Edgerton. The successful candidate is responsible for performing assigned duties for all phases of operation, maintenance, repair and upkeep of utility infrastructure, utility buildings, equipment, property.
This position performs work for both water and wastewater utility departments, including daily, monthly, and annual water monitoring and testing as well as regular inspections and cleaning of infrastructure. Qualified candidates must have a high school diploma, or equivalent, and must successfully pass pre-employment screenings, such as background check, physical and drug check. Experience is not required for the Utility Maintenance Technician I level, and the City will provide appropriate training for the successful candidate(s). Candidates should possess the ability to obtain a Class I certification within one year.
